 Trusting God in stead of man by Erlo Stegen

Topic:
Scripture(s): Isaiah 31:1-3  
Description: The Assyrians were strong and the Israelites were afraid of them. They therefore wanted to acquire more horses and hire the Egyptians to help them. God however warned them that it would bode ill for them if they trusted in man, horses and chariots for deliverance. They should in the first place trust the Lord. You may put your trust in other things, as in money, but the same woe will be on you unless you trust in the Lord. King Asa was a great king; but when he was old and diseased in his feat, he sought the help of physicians and did not trust the Lord. Because of this he lost out on many blessings!

 Church Increase by C. H. Spurgeon

Topic:
Scripture(s): Isaiah 49:20-21  
Description: I do not expect to say anything upon this subject which will interest those who have no love for the Church of God; but those who belong to her, and who are spending their lives to promote her welfare because she is the bride of Christ, will, I trust, find something in what I say which will interest and perhaps encourage them. I shall come at once to the text, and notice that, first, we must expect a measure of decrease in the Church; but then, secondly, we may expect a great increase in the Church; and, thirdly, from what this text has to say upon that subject, and for other reasons also, we ought to be encouraged to seek the increase of the Church of God.
